Generative AI is a newer form of artificial intelligence (AI) that differs from other AI approaches primarily because it creates original content, while other AI approaches analyze or classify existing data and information. In this course, learn generative AI concepts such as tokens, chunking, embeddings, vectors, prompt engineering, transformer-based LLMs, foundation models, multi-modal models, and diffusion models. Next, explore potential use cases for generative AI models, like image, video, and audio generation, as well as summarization, chatbots, translation, code generation, customer service agents, and search and recommendation engines. Finally, examine the foundation model lifecycle phases, including data selection, model selection, pre-training, fine-tuning, evaluation, deployment, and feedback. This course is part of a collection that prepares you for the AIF-C01: AWS Certified AI Practitioner exam.
